According to the product specialist
Pros
The reflective details improve your visibility. |
Suitable for fastening systems like Racktime, i-Rack or Carrymore because of the Basil Universal Bridge System. |
The adjustable click closures enable you to adapt the panniers to the amount of luggage you want to take. |
With the foldable sides, the panniers can be made smaller when empty. |
The panniers are made of water repellent material so that a rain shower is no problem. |
The curved sides mean they don't touch your shoes as you cycle. |
The panniers are easy to open and close thanks to the click closure at the top of the flap. |
Don't worry about your gear getting wet, as they're water repellent. |
At 40 litres, the Basil Tour XL are more than spacious enough for large shopping and daytrips on the bike. |
Cons
Doesn't have compartments. |
There are no dividers inside the panniers. |
